| Details: CHAPTER ONE The Scientific Literature of Dream-Problems (up to 1900) In the following pages, I shall demonstrate that there is a psychological technique which 
        makes it possible to interpret dreams, and that on the application of this technique, every 
        dream will reveal itself as a psychological structure, full of significance, and one which 
        may be assigned to a specific place in the psychic activities of the waking state.
  Further, I shall endeavour to elucidate the processes which underlie the strangeness and obscurity of dreams, and to deduce from these processes the nature of the psychic forces whose
 conflict or co-operation is responsible for our dreams.
 This done, my investigation will 
        terminate, as it will have reached the point where the problem of the dream merges into 
        more comprehensive problems, and to solve these, we must have recourse to material of a
